Now, let’s dive into some cool facts about the 1996 Dodge Dakota Club Cab. Released as part of the second generation of the Dakota lineup, the Club Cab version offered extended cab seating with additional space behind the front seats. This innovative design provided a perfect blend of comfort and utility.

The 1996 Dodge Dakota Club Cab came with a range of engine options, including a 2.5-liter four-cylinder engine, a 3.9-liter V6 engine, and a powerful 5.2-liter V8 engine. With its sturdy construction and powerful engines, the 1996 Dodge Dakota Club Cab was well-suited for hauling and towing tasks.

In terms of safety features, the 1996 Dodge Dakota Club Cab included standard driver and passenger airbags, side-impact protection, and anti-lock brakes. These safety features were considered advanced for their time, ensuring the well-being of the vehicle’s occupants.

The 1996 Dodge Dakota Club Cab also had various optional features, such as power windows, power mirrors, and a premium sound system. These added elements enhanced the driving experience and made the truck more appealing to potential buyers.
